Drainage line replacement services involve removing and installing new underground pipes that direct water away from a property. This process typically includes excavating sections of the existing drainage system, removing damaged or outdated pipes, and installing new ones that meet current standards. Properly replacing drainage lines helps ensure that water flows efficiently away from foundations, basements, and yards, reducing the risk of water pooling or flooding. These services are essential for maintaining the structural integrity of a property and preventing water-related issues that can cause damage over time.
This service addresses a variety of common problems associated with aging or compromised drainage systems. Blockages, cracks, corrosion, and broken pipes can lead to poor water flow, backups, and overflows. In some cases, tree roots may invade underground pipes, causing blockages and structural damage. Drainage line replacement helps eliminate these issues by restoring a clear and functional system, which can prevent costly repairs and property damage caused by water intrusion or erosion.

The overview below groups typical Drainage Line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ottawa County,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ost Range for Drainage Line Replacement - Typical expenses for replacing drainage lines can vary between $1,500 and $4,500, depending on the property's size and pipe material. For example, a standard residential replacement might cost around $2,500. Local service providers can provide specific estimates based on individual needs.
Factors Influencing Cost - The overall cost depends on factors such as pipe length, depth, and accessibility. Repairs involving extensive excavation or difficult access may increase costs beyond the average range. Contractors often factor in these variables when providing quotes.
Average Cost for Materials and Labor - Material costs generally range from $50 to $150 per linear foot, with labor costs adding to the total. For a typical home drainage line replacement of 50 feet, the total might fall between $2,000 and $4,000. Local pros can help determine precise pricing based on project scope.
Additional Cost Considerations - Permitting, site restoration, and potential troubleshooting can add to the overall expense. These supplementary costs vary by location and project complexity. Service providers can offer detailed cost estimates after assessing the specific site requ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a drainage line needs replacement? Signs include persistent clogs, foul odors, water backups, or visible damage to pipes, indicating a possible need for drainage line replacement.
How long does a drainage line replacement usually take? The duration can vary depending on the extent of the work, but typically, replacement services are completed within a day or two.
Are drainage line replacements disruptive to property? Some disruption may occur during replacement work, such as minor excavation, but professional contractors aim to minimize impact on the property.
What causes drainage lines to fail? Common causes include age, tree root intrusion, shifting soil, corrosion, or blockages that lead to deterioration over time.
